Physical description
A piece of bone fragment of the Shang dynasty (16th century BCE-11th century BCE. It has part of the so called taotie 饕餮 mask which also appears and decorates archaic ritual bronze vessels of the Shang 商 dynasty as represented in the NGV Chinese collection. The design typically consists of a zoomorphic mask.
